    that's only the tip of the iceberg boys.... when I was designing for the main stream industry, I was always shocked to find out that so and so owned this and that and operated such and such

    the deal is this, I was always told by marketing experts that consumers like to have "choice" as they put it.... this allows the consumer to think that they play a roll in making intelligent decisions before they shop

    case in point, this whole nightmare with pet foods - what a shock it was (for most consumers) to find that high end and low end pet food products were and are actually produced by ONE company

    also, in many airport food courts - in my former days as an airport desing planner - most all of the food choices were and still are owned and operated by Marriott - (with some obvious exceptions - starubucks) - by providing "choice" consumers think that they "can" make a choice

    this holds true for all manufacturing including OIL production - the oil industry often trades products and fills in when shortages occur... often delivering fuel products in unmarked trucks...

    disney operates mammoth real estate enterprises under independently operated companies that buy, sell and trade all kinds of properties, etc, etc, etc....

    the really bizarre thing for me was when I learned how many of these enormous enterprises are NOT owned (formally) by US companies....

    Quote Originally Posted by CamCruise View Post
    OUCH!!! Do you drive or take transit or just bike it around town?
    I take the car

    parking downtown is €1,50 /hour
    its about 20 km back and fort and I use 8 liter per 100 km - so its about 2 litre of gas
    total = (parkinghrs * 1,5) + (2 * €1,40) = €5,80

    Masstransit to downtown frankfurt ONE WAY is €2,10 so back and forth €4,20

    I am usually accompanied by my BF when we go downtown so it would be €8,40 for us two....

    That's why I take the car
